Also to know is, who commands the Canadian Armed Forces?
The Commander-in-Chief of the Canadian Armed Forces (French: Commandant en chef des Forces armées canadiennes) is the supreme commander of Canada's armed forces. Constitutionally, command-in-chief is vested in the Canadian sovereign, presently Queen Elizabeth II.
Additionally, how strong is the Canadian military? At about 50,000 strong, less than half a per cent of Canadians are currently enlisted in their country's armed forces, and among NATO members, only tiny Luxembourg spends less of its GDP on defence. Nevertheless, the Canadian military remains a proud national symbol just the same.

17 years of ageHas Canada been in a war?
Canada has been involved in four major wars. Namely, the War of 1812, the First World War, the Second World War, and the Korean War. It also fought during the conflict in Afghanistan which began in 2002 and ended in 2014. In the Second World War, Canada had a population of approximately 11 million.How big is the Canadian military?
